Output 86538371d1b3e42061ed90a81a8c51d60760b525f017e8240dec0b34aaebcec3:18

value
3119
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 00e8d5136604d5e65dc4f50d1dcdfd221cba9e9712bdc00a4bfd133e01e04358
address
bc1pqr5d2ymxqn27vhwy75x3mn0aygwt485hz27uqzjtl5fnuq0qgdvq02tw9l
transaction
86538371d1b3e42061ed90a81a8c51d60760b525f017e8240dec0b34aaebcec3
spent
true